+               /*
+                * We are going to log the inode size change in this
+                * transaction so any previous writes that are beyond the on
+                * disk EOF and the new EOF that have not been written out need
+                * to be written here. If we do not write the data out, we
+                * expose ourselves to the null files problem.
+                *
+                * Only flush from the on disk size to the smaller of the in
+                * memory file size or the new size as that's the range we
+                * really care about here and prevents waiting for other data
+                * not within the range we care about here.
+                */
